Abstract
The utility model discloses a solar heating device of rural sewage treatment facilities, which belongs to the technical field of sewage treatment and solves the problem that the prior device can not adjust the inclination angle of a solar heat collecting plate, so that the device can not fully utilize solar energy; the technical characteristics are as follows: the solar heat collecting device comprises a supporting seat, wherein a hinged seat is fixedly installed on the supporting seat, a solar heat collecting plate is installed on the hinged seat, a driving cavity is arranged in the supporting seat, an adjusting component is arranged in the driving cavity, the adjusting component is connected with the solar heat collecting plate, and the hinged seat and the solar heat collecting plate are rotatably connected through a rotating shaft; the embodiment of the utility model provides a set up adjusting part, adjusting part's setting has realized making things convenient for solar panel to the absorption of solar energy to solar panel inclination's regulation, and the protection to solar panel has been realized to setting up of rain-proof subassembly, has avoided solar panel's damage.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Example 1
As shown in fig. 1-2, in the embodiment of the present invention, a solar heating apparatus for rural sewage treatment facilities comprises a supporting seat 1, a hinged seat 3 is fixedly mounted on the supporting seat 1, a solar heat collecting plate 4 is mounted on the hinged seat 3, a driving chamber 2 is provided in the supporting seat 1, an adjusting component is provided in the driving chamber 2, and the adjusting component is connected with the solar heat collecting plate 4.
The hinged seat 3 is rotationally connected with the solar heat collecting plate 4 through a rotating shaft;
as shown in fig. 4, the adjusting assembly comprises a screw rod 15 and an adjusting wheel 16, one end of the screw rod 15 is rotatably connected with the supporting seat 1 through a bearing, the other end of the screw rod 15 is fixedly provided with the adjusting wheel 16, a threaded block 13 is sleeved outside the screw rod 15, the threaded block 13 is in threaded connection with the screw rod 15, the upper part of the threaded block 13 is fixedly connected with an upright post 10, the upper end of the upright post 10 is hinged with a hinged block 12, the hinged block 12 is movably arranged in a hinged groove 11, and the hinged groove 11 is fixedly arranged on the lower wall of the solar heat collecting plate 4;
when the inclination angle of the solar heat collecting plate 4 needs to be adjusted, the adjusting wheel 16 is rotated, the adjusting wheel 16 drives the screw rod 15 to rotate, the screw rod 15 drives the threaded block 13 to horizontally move, so that the threaded block 13 drives the upright post 10 to move, and the upright post 10 drives the hinge block 12 to move, so that the inclination angle of the solar heat collecting plate 4 is adjusted, and the solar energy is conveniently absorbed;
in the embodiment of the present invention, the solar heat collecting plate 4 is not limited herein as the prior art.
As shown in fig. 3, a rain shielding assembly for protecting the solar heat collecting plate 4 is further arranged on the supporting seat 1, the rain shielding assembly comprises a rain shielding cover 5 and an angle adjusting rod 6, the angle adjusting rod 6 is fixedly connected to the rain shielding cover 5, a rotary table 7 is fixedly connected to the bottom of the angle adjusting rod 6 through a bolt, the rotary table 7 is mounted on the supporting seat 1, the rotary table 7 is rotatably connected with the supporting seat 1, a first hinge rod 8 is hinged to the front side wall of the rotary table 7, a second hinge rod 9 is hinged to one end, away from the rotary table 7, of the first hinge rod 8, and an upright post 10 is fixedly connected to one end, away from the first hinge rod 8, of the second hinge rod 9;
the stand 10 removes and can drive first articulated mast 8 and the removal of second articulated mast 9, thereby make 8 pulling turntables 7 of first articulated mast rotate, turntables 7 drive angle adjusting rod 6 and weather shield 5 rotate, thereby make rain subassembly and solar panel 4 realize synchronous motion, realize the protection to solar panel 4 when not influencing the daylighting of solar panel 4, the service life of solar panel 4 has been prolonged, the damage of solar panel 4 has been avoided.
